PE Ratio without NRI / 5-Year EBITDA Growth Rate*

PEG Ratio is defined as the PE Ratio without NRI divided by the growth ratio. The growth rate we use is the 5-Year EBITDA growth rate. As of today, AB Dynamics's PE Ratio without NRI is 13.90. AB Dynamics's 5-Year EBITDA growth rate is 22.50%. Therefore, AB Dynamics's PEG Ratio for today is 0.62.

* The 5-Year EBITDA Growth Rate is the 5-year average EBITDA per share growth rate. While the denominator is a percentage, we use the whole number as opposed to the decimal form for the calculation. For example, 5% would be shown as 5 as opposed to 0.05. If it's smaller than or equal to 0, then the PEG Ratio is not calculated.

AB Dynamics  (OTCPK:ABDDF) PEG Ratio Explanation

To compare stocks with different growth rates, Peter Lynch invented a ratio called PEG Ratio. PEG Ratio is defined as the P/E ratio divided by the growth ratio. He thinks a company with a P/E ratio equal to its growth rate is fairly valued. Still he said he would rather buy a company growing 20% a year with a P/E of 20, instead of a company growing 10% a year with a P/E of 10.

AB Dynamics Business Description

Other Exchanges ABDPl:UKABDP:UK6DY:Germany
Address Middleton Drive, Bradford on Avon, Wiltshire, GBR, BA15 1GB
AB Dynamics PLC supplies measurement and testing equipment to the automotive industry. The principal activity of the Group is the design, manufacture, and supply of testing, simulation and measurement products for the world-wide transport market. The Group's products and services are used for the development of road vehicles, particularly in the areas of active safety and autonomous systems. The Groups segments include: Testing Products, Testing services, and Simulation.
